Analysts are the revenue drivers of this company. The role of the analyst is a full-time, remote role dedicated to researching and investing in event tickets. The role has two main functions:
The development, implementation, and execution of purchasing tickets for the company.
Collaborating with our pricing team to closely manage the selling of our inventory
While there are only two main functions, the scope of this work is vast and constantly changing. Due to this fact, innovation has been a vital part of our tremendous growth.
There are three key ways innovation is thought about on this team:
Innovation from Within: Creative solutions come from anyone. We foster an open, cross-functional environment where everyone is encouraged to give feedback on current company operations and practices.
Innovation from Technology: Automation generates revenue. We invest in creative driven employees who are willing to tackle current technological limitations.
Innovation from Experience: Learn from doing. We strive to incorporate past experiences to solve current problems.
